Jump to content
Sign in to follow this  
jotade2

Calcular numero veces condicion lleva sin darse

Recommended Posts

mensaje al moderador del foro: he preguntado este mismo tema en el foro de VBA, se que no se debe repetir la misma pregunta en ambos foros, pido comprension porque me he dado cuenta que quizas puedo resolver el problema sin tener que recurrir a VBA, si es asi y el moderador quiere borrar el mensaje del foro VBA lo comprendo y le pido disculpas por las molestias originadas...

bien, he venido haciendo una tabla en la que calculo el numero de veces que una condicion se da, para ello he usado las formulas que podeis ver en la columna B, el problema me ha sobrevenido cuando el numero de datos a analizar es muy grande, al tener que repetir las formulas de la columna B el uso de recursos se me ha disparado, con un consumo exagerado de memoria, llegando a tener 250000 formulas excel llega a bloquearse...

queriendo evitar las formulas de la columna B he resuelto la formula que cuenta el numero de veces facilmente usando COUNTIF.

la segunda cosa que calculo es cuantas veces lleva sin darse esa condicion, lo cual he resuelto con la formula matricial que podeis ver en la casilla C6

el problema el que os dije arriba, tengo que evitar las formulas de la columna B.. en fin, adjunto archivo para que entendais lo que ando buscando

sin mas, un saludo y gracias de antemano por vuestra atencion

Book1.zip

Share this post


Link to post
Share on other sites

Hola [uSER=214395]@jotade2[/uSER]

Puedes usar:

=BUSCAR(2;1/A1:A1000;FILA(A1:A1000))-BUSCAR(2;1/(A1:A1000=2);FILA(A1:A1000))[/PHP]

¡Bendiciones!

P.D: Un saludo [uSER=191928]@Luis Teran[/uSER]...

Share this post


Link to post
Share on other sites
Saludos [uSER=214395]@jotade2[/uSER] a lo que entendí aquí le envío una opción, vea si es lo que buscaba.

Que tenga un gran día.

va estupendamente, GRACIAS

abusando un poco de tu amabilidad...,si quiero poner otra condicion como lo haria? por ejemplo que cuente cuantas veces lleva sin salir un numero par, un impar, o que los datos de la columna A sean mayor que los de B? o que A+B sean mayor que, digamos por ejemplo 5?

Share this post


Link to post
Share on other sites

Que bueno que la haya servido [uSER=214395]@jotade2[/uSER] (un gran saludo para el gran maestro [uSER=113842]@johnmpl[/uSER]). Aquí le mando un adjunto para que pueda ver como editar la fórmula para las condiciones que menciona. Ya usted conozca bien su funcionamiento, me parece que podrá editarlas de mejor manera y con mejor rendimiento.

E incluso podría incursionar en las olvidadas funciones de base de datos, BDCONTAR, BDSUMAR entre otras. que de seguro le servirán (no hice ejemplos con estas fórmulas, debido a que deben cumplir unos requisitos que talvez no sean de su total agrado, pero igual le recomiendo que las conozca y use, son muy buenas ;))

Revisé el adjunto cuidadosamente (vea si en algo me equivoque) y que tenga un gran día

churobook2.rar

Share this post


Link to post
Share on other sites

[uSER=214395]@jotade2[/uSER]

No se admiten archivos con contraseña.

Puesto que tu consulta inicial y una más fue solucionada, este tema se da por solucionado.

Sugiero abras nuevo tema si tienes consultas añadidas.

Saludos

Share this post


Link to post
Share on other sites
Guest
This topic is now closed to further replies.

INFORMACIÓN BÁSICA SOBRE PROTECCIÓN DE DATOS

Responsable: Sergio Andrés Celemín

Finalidad: Moderar y responder comentarios de usuarios. Recuerda que la información que facilites es pública, y los datos que incluyas los leerá cualquier visitante de esta web, así como el avatar que poseas.

Legitimación: Consentimiento del interesado.

Destinatarios: Hetzner Online GmbH.

Derechos: Puedes ejercitar en cualquier momento tus derechos de acceso,
rectificación, supresión, oposición y demás derechos legalmente establecidos a
través del email sergio@ayudaexcel.com.

Información adicional: Encontrarás más información en la política de privacidad.

Sign in to follow this  



×
×
  • Create New...

Important Information

Privacy Policy


CTA Templates.png